  This seems to be a bug with RJDBC package and it has been fixed in the
latest RJDBC_0.1-6 version. I would like to try out RJDBC_0.1-6. can you
please guide me to a link where i can find the 64-bit RJDBC_0.1-6.zip . I
could find the 32-bit version at
http://cran.sixsigmaonline.org/bin/windows/contrib/2.11/ ?

RJDBC_0.2-0 seesm to be recent and binaries are available for recent versions of R on all CRAN mirrors. If you need a binary for an ancient version of R, you have to compile it yourself.
